Output debe251e62bf17bbdb53ca9227e503d2bd073384fada2791eebfb526ea9daca5:0

value
19427686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a3dbe55f85b603dec82717b8f5fbf4f7a43968 OP_EQUAL
address
3Poyk62TJa8hAWC1zfveaBZEQTbJKMpaiu
transaction
debe251e62bf17bbdb53ca9227e503d2bd073384fada2791eebfb526ea9daca5
confirmations
452600
spent
true